The garage occupancy feed for the Brindlewood campus arrives over a message queue every thirty seconds, one record per level, published by the Stallgrid edge boxes. Counts can briefly go negative when a sensor double-fires on exit; the ingest job clamps these to zero and flags the interval. If the feed stalls for more than five minutes, the dashboard falls back to the last known snapshot. Sensor mappings, queue names, and the replay procedure are documented on the internal page below.

runbook for tahog-kadug: https://gitlab.qirvanworks.corp/projects/pages/view/b139298aed28

## Environment variables — Tailwick internal log-tailing CLI

Tailwick streams logs from our Hollowpine aggregator to engineer workstations. From a security standpoint, note that `TAILWICK_REDACT=on` is enforced at the server and cannot be disabled client-side; `TAILWICK_RETENTION_HINT` is advisory only. Sessions are read-only and scoped per team. Every audit-relevant action is logged server-side with the caller's identity. The CLI authenticates with a short-lived token, which the env file declares on the line that follows.

env line for kawef-bajop: VAULT_KEY13=bcea803fc73c3

**Handover: Lanternbridge health checks**

Handing this off mid-review. The Lanternbridge API sits behind the shared load balancer, and its health endpoint currently only checks process liveness, not downstream database reachability — that's why the balancer kept routing to a half-dead node last week. My open PR adds a dependency-aware check with a separate readiness path. When reviewing, please confirm the timeouts line up with the values below.

service settings:
[ulair]
team = praath
access_code = ac_06d704
owner = wenix.ulair
host = ulair.qirvancorp.corp
port = 9200
peer = sorys.nelvronet.internal
salt = 2668132c
pin = 9140

**Q: How do we keep user-supplied formulas from doing anything nasty?**

A: Every formula in Gridlet runs inside the Calcbox sandbox — no file access, no network, hard CPU and memory caps. If a formula times out, it just returns an error cell. Don't try to bypass the sandbox for "quick" evals, ever. Full details on the sandbox architecture are written up here:

wiki page, fahaf-yagag: https://confluence.qorvellabs.internal/pages/display/pages/display